Output 30c4af69cc794df8e92a96b744e43704bfc5fd1df71e03ac2cb6132589671814:5

value
282144452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f59009a5a33ede64197e742fcd117f0d2a985ce OP_EQUAL
address
MRLuv4YKmN8iiCcHAssWdwNEzMYiuG8QUu
transaction
30c4af69cc794df8e92a96b744e43704bfc5fd1df71e03ac2cb6132589671814
spent
true